The Origins of Trapstar
Trapstar was created in West London by three friends—Mikey, Lee, and Will. They began by printing T-shirts and selling them within their community. The brand name blends two ideas: “Trap”, representing hustle and struggle, and “Star”, symbolizing ambition and success. This balance of grit and glory built the brand’s identity.

Music and Trapstar
Music has always been central to the brand’s growth. UK grime and rap stars first wore Trapstar. Later, international names like Rihanna, Jay-Z, and A$AP Rocky gave it global reach. The bond between music and fashion cemented Trapstar as a cultural icon.
